Abstract

A curing system including a curing press-post inflator combination wherein the tire moves through the curing and post inflation process under complete control at all times. The post inflator is mounted on the press frame and is aligned with the top mold section of the press in the full open position of the press. The upper or outside bead rim of the post inflator is removed by a mechanism operating, in part, independently of the press top mold section so that the post inflator can be closed and operational prior to the full closing of the press. A chuck in the top mold section not only holds the tire for stripping from the mold sections and bladder but retains control over the tire vertically to place the tire without dropping or any lateral movement on the aligned open bottom or inner bead rim of the post cure inflator.
